The Lotus Emeya will silence any criticism surrounding the Eletre. As an electric sports sedan, it has to be convincing and able to outperform the Porsche Taycan. More than 300 kilometers above the Arctic Circle, we have entered the final test phase before production begins.

With the Eletre introduced last year, the new Lotus managed to make an impressive impression, but at the same time it was also deeply disappointing. Good due to the quality of workmanship, the use of materials, the multimedia system and the refined driving characteristics. But For the drivers, is Lotus’ motto, and is absolutely not a luxury giant due to its lack of dynamism. The Emeya has to do more justice to these sayings and it is not for nothing that the Porsche Taycan was the benchmark in development.

Steer with your foot in the Lotus Emeya

Now turn everything off, watch out for the snow banks and see what the Emeya can do on this drift circle,” a Lotus instructor challenges us. The five-meter-long electric grand tourer skids on the rear wheel and attempts are made to hold it there. The steering wheel points to the right, the nose turns to the left and the tires create a white haze behind the Lotus. In this automotive obstacle, the Porsche competitor shows his reflexes in difficult situations and a playful side of himself that the Eletre lacks. Steer with the gas and correct with the steering wheel.

Lotus uses the harsh environment for the finishing touches, but above all to give four international journalists the opportunity to get to know the driving characteristics of the Emeya. This 2500 kilogram Lotus is back For the drivers?
